Couple stops attempted sexual assault in Palmdale, suspect in custody

A couple stopped an attempted sexual assault on a woman in Palmdale, and a suspect was in custody, authorities said Friday.

Deputies responded at 8:23 p.m. Thursday to 39940 10th Street West regarding reports of an alleged attempted sexual assault in the parking lot of a Sam’s Club, Sgt. Ryan Bodily of the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department told City News Service.

Witnesses told deputies that a man attacked the victim and that a couple intervened, with one of them using pepper spray, according to Bodily.

The alleged assailant fled but was later captured and arrested, Bodily said.

Specific charges were not yet available.

Bodily said the victim was taken to a hospital with unknown injuries.
